However small timers like you and I are already existing Daz studio users.

The true growth comes from gaining NEW users and it is my view that Daz's fixation on Maya plugins for genesis is a largely a wasted effort.

Granted that Auotdesk now has a $300 USD per year indie version for their products you may see a few more people who might buy the upcoming DSON based Dex plugin, as Maya is now actually affordable.

However the majority of the Maya user base are either already working in the CG /VFX film industry or are seeking to become employed by that industry.

Thus they tend to be very "dismissive of any pipeline that is not following the standards and practices of that industry.

This is what Daz has Failed to understand with these Genesis to Maya plugins as well as their unmitigated Failure to impress the unity Game dev market with: Morph3D, then Morph ID and now "Tafi3D" :-/
